39 #include <sys/cdefs.h>
40 __KERNEL_RCSID(0, "$NetBSD: wdc_isapnp.c,v 1.27 2004/05/25 20:42:41 thorpej Exp $");
41 
42 #include <sys/param.h>
43 #include <sys/systm.h>
44 #include <sys/device.h>
45 #include <sys/malloc.h>
46 
47 #include <machine/bus.h>
48 #include <machine/intr.h>
49 
50 #include <dev/isa/isavar.h>
51 #include <dev/isa/isadmavar.h>
52 
53 #include <dev/isapnp/isapnpreg.h>
54 #include <dev/isapnp/isapnpvar.h>
55 #include <dev/isapnp/isapnpdevs.h>
56 
57 #include <dev/ata/atavar.h>
58 #include <dev/ic/wdcreg.h>
59 #include <dev/ic/wdcvar.h>
60 
61 struct wdc_isapnp_softc {
62 	struct	wdc_softc sc_wdcdev;
63 	struct	wdc_channel *wdc_chanlist[1];
64 	struct	wdc_channel wdc_channel;
65 	struct	ata_queue wdc_chqueue;
66 	isa_chipset_tag_t sc_ic;
67 	void	*sc_ih;
68 	int	sc_drq;
69 };
70 
71 int	wdc_isapnp_probe 	__P((struct device *, struct cfdata *, void *));
72 void	wdc_isapnp_attach 	__P((struct device *, struct device *, void *));
73 
74 CFATTACH_DECL(wdc_isapnp, sizeof(struct wdc_isapnp_softc),
75     wdc_isapnp_probe, wdc_isapnp_attach, NULL, NULL);
76 
77 #ifdef notyet
78 static void	wdc_isapnp_dma_setup __P((struct wdc_isapnp_softc *));
79 static void	wdc_isapnp_dma_start __P((void *, void *, size_t, int));
80 static void	wdc_isapnp_dma_finish __P((void *));
81 #endif
82 
83 int
84 wdc_isapnp_probe(parent, match, aux)
85 	struct device *parent;
86 	struct cfdata *match;
87 	void *aux;
88 {
89 	int pri, variant;
90 
91 	pri = isapnp_devmatch(aux, &isapnp_wdc_devinfo, &variant);
92 	if (pri && variant > 0)
93 		pri = 0;
94 	return (pri);
95 }
96 
97 void
98 wdc_isapnp_attach(parent, self, aux)
99 	struct device *parent, *self;
100 	void *aux;
101 {
102 	struct wdc_isapnp_softc *sc = (void *)self;
103 	struct isapnp_attach_args *ipa = aux;
104 	int i;
105 
106 	if (ipa->ipa_nio != 2 ||
107 	    ipa->ipa_nmem != 0 ||
108 	    ipa->ipa_nmem32 != 0 ||
109 	    ipa->ipa_nirq != 1 ||
110 	    ipa->ipa_ndrq > 1) {
111 		printf(": unexpected configuration\n");
112 		return;
113 	}
114 
115 	if (isapnp_config(ipa->ipa_iot, ipa->ipa_memt, ipa)) {
116 		printf(": couldn't map registers\n");
117 		return;
118 	}
119 
120 	printf(": %s %s\n", ipa->ipa_devident, ipa->ipa_devclass);
121 
122 	sc->wdc_channel.cmd_iot = ipa->ipa_iot;
123 	sc->wdc_channel.ctl_iot = ipa->ipa_iot;
124 	/*
125 	 * An IDE controller can feed us the regions in any order. Pass
126 	 * them along with the 8-byte region in sc_ad.ioh, and the other
127 	 * (2 byte) region in auxioh.
128 	 */
129 	if (ipa->ipa_io[0].length == 8) {
130 		sc->wdc_channel.cmd_baseioh = ipa->ipa_io[0].h;
131 		sc->wdc_channel.ctl_ioh = ipa->ipa_io[1].h;
132 	} else {
133 		sc->wdc_channel.cmd_baseioh = ipa->ipa_io[1].h;
134 		sc->wdc_channel.ctl_ioh = ipa->ipa_io[0].h;
135 	}
136 
137 	for (i = 0; i < WDC_NREG; i++) {
138 		if (bus_space_subregion(sc->wdc_channel.cmd_iot,
139 		    sc->wdc_channel.cmd_baseioh, i, i == 0 ? 4 : 1,
140 		    &sc->wdc_channel.cmd_iohs[i]) != 0) {
141 			printf(": couldn't subregion registers\n");
142 			return;
143 		}
144 	}
145 	wdc_init_shadow_regs(&sc->wdc_channel);
146 	sc->wdc_channel.data32iot = sc->wdc_channel.cmd_iot;
147 	sc->wdc_channel.data32ioh = sc->wdc_channel.cmd_iohs[0];
148 
149 	sc->sc_ic = ipa->ipa_ic;
150 	sc->sc_ih = isa_intr_establish(ipa->ipa_ic, ipa->ipa_irq[0].num,
151 	    ipa->ipa_irq[0].type, IPL_BIO, wdcintr, &sc->wdc_channel);
152 
153 #ifdef notyet
154 	if (ipa->ipa_ndrq > 0) {
155 		sc->sc_drq = ipa->ipa_drq[0].num;
156 
157 		sc->sc_ad.cap |= WDC_CAPABILITY_DMA;
158 		sc->sc_ad.dma_start = &wdc_isapnp_dma_start;
159 		sc->sc_ad.dma_finish = &wdc_isapnp_dma_finish;
160 		wdc_isapnp_dma_setup(sc);
161 	}
162 #endif
163 	sc->sc_wdcdev.cap |= WDC_CAPABILITY_DATA16 | WDC_CAPABILITY_DATA32;
164 	sc->sc_wdcdev.PIO_cap = 0;
165 	sc->wdc_chanlist[0] = &sc->wdc_channel;
166 	sc->sc_wdcdev.channels = sc->wdc_chanlist;
167 	sc->sc_wdcdev.nchannels = 1;
168 	sc->wdc_channel.ch_channel = 0;
169 	sc->wdc_channel.ch_wdc = &sc->sc_wdcdev;
170 	sc->wdc_channel.ch_queue = &sc->wdc_chqueue;
171 
172 	wdcattach(&sc->wdc_channel);
173 }
